UFC on FX 7 attendance, gate and bonuses

January 19, 2013 by Jason Cruz 3 Comments

MMA Junkie reports the attendance, gate and bonuses for UFC on FX 7.  The attendance for the event in San Paulo, Brazil was a sellout with 9,116 fans.

Bonuses were announced and each fighter received $50,000 for their efforts:

KO of the Night: Vitor Belfort
Submission of the Night:  Ildemar Alcantra
Fight of the Night:  CB Dolloway v. Danial Sarafian

The main event saw an upset as Vitor Belfort pleased the crowd with a second round TKO of Michael Bisping.  The loss derails Bisping’s chance for a title shot against Anderson Silva.

Payout Perspective:

With the loss of Michael Bisping, what does the UFC do next for Anderson Silva? Vitor Belfort again?  Chris Weidman?

As for the event, it was another good showing by the Brazilian fans.  San Paulo should definitely see another event in its city.
